Abu Jad’ha Kabir
Abu Jad’ha Kabir is a village in Aleppo Governorate, Syria and has about 580 residents. Abu Jad’ha Kabir is situated nearby to the village Tell Abu Jadha, as well as near the hamlet Abu Jad’ha Saghir.| Tap on a place to explore it |
